Ice Blue fondant ?
Andy Birkenhead
08-06-2014
What colour icing is the best to use for ice, as in a "Frozen" cake ?
Renshaws do 'Baby Blue' icing. Is this the best to use ?

i peronally think the paler the blue the more chilly the cake looks, i think baby blue would be ok.if you think its not right knead some white fondant into it
